Transaction 290110ee610a9222f7b561fd63bb8828d1a4d462891619c15b380ca8170e5eaa
1 Input
1 Output
-
290110ee610a9222f7b561fd63bb8828d1a4d462891619c15b380ca8170e5eaa:0
- value
- 1974569
- script pubkey
- OP_0 OP_PUSHBYTES_20 16dd972e66155b1b41c0254e860cdc254f8c3335
- address
- bc1qzmwewtnxz4d3kswqy48gvrxuy48ccve468fvd2